A crypto asset known for its proof-of-stake (POS) blockchain. It was first developed by the co-founder of Ethereum in 2015 and launched in 2017. It is also used for the application of smart contracts. This crypto asset is also believed to be the better version of Ethereum.

Sia acts as a secure, trustless marketplace for cloud storage in which users can lease access to their unused storage space. The main goal of the project is to become the "backbone storage layer of the internet."
